Getting There

Public transit is a beast; the Metro Line 2 surges like a locomotive at game time. Grab a MetroCard, set alerts on your phone, and aim for the station three stops before the stadium. Taxis? Overpriced and unreliable when the city swarms. Ride‑share? Safer, but expect surge pricing. By the way, park your car in the lot near Estadio Tlahuac and walk the final 800 meters; you’ll beat the traffic jam.

Stadium Atmosphere

Azteca isn’t just a bowl; it’s a cathedral of noise. The pre‑match drum circle starts 30 minutes before kickoff, reverberating through the concrete arches. If you’re into the chants, arrive early, locate the fan zone, and learn the “Grita, Grita” chant from the veterans. Two‑word advice: Feel it.

Food & Drink

Street tacos versus the official concession? The taco stalls outside the north gate serve al pastor that could outshine any stadium offering. Grab a churro, a cold cerveza, and you’ll be fueled for the entire 90 minutes. Avoid the “gourmet burger” area; you’ll waste time in line while the first half ends. Quick tip: cash is king; most vendors still prefer pesos over cards.

Safety & Security

Security checkpoints are tight, but they’re not a nightmare. Keep your bag light, avoid large backpacks, and have your ticket ready on your phone. The metal detectors hum like a low‑frequency riff; you’ll breeze through if you’re prepared.
